Q: Is 724,405 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 724,405 is a composite number.

Why is 724,405 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 724,405 can be evenly divided by 1 5 11 55 13,171 65,855 144,881 and 724,405, with no remainder.

Since 724,405 cannot be divided by just 1 and 724,405, it is a composite number.
